The Chemistry of Nickel Carbonyl Watch/Listen...
Never heard of it ?
The metal nickel reacts directly with carbon monoxide, forming nickel carbonyl. On breathing it in, it decomposes releasing CO and coating lung tissue with nickel ....... ouch ! But studying led to breakthroughs in our understanding of transition metals.

The Chemistry of AgCNO Watch/Listen...
AgCNO - silver fulminate or silver cyanate ?
2 Compounds with exactly the same formula ........ one a harmless, stable powder ...the other ..... a percussion explosive (tap the table and BANG !!!!). WHY ......?
